British Boxers Check Brushed Cotton Pyjama Set
£57.50 – £115.00
£57.50 – £115.00
£31.99 – £39.99
£234.95£187.96
£224.95£179.96
£111.44 – £159.20
£170.00£136.00
£209.00 – £319.00
£65.00£45.50£33.00
£79.99£45.99
Exclusive to John Lewis and Brora
£230.00£128.00
£365.00£255.50
£230.00£128.00
£60.00£42.00£30.00
£179.00£125.30
£89.00£50.00
£69.99£42.00£35.00
£109.99£77.00